RPGA Design Group, Inc. - Architects


Created in 1989 by brothers Rick and Robert Garza, and later joined by Javier Lucio in 1995, RPGA has grown to a talented staff of 18 with over 150 years of combined experience. RPGA engages in a wide variety of project types including single family residential, large scale residential, multi family, commercial, civic, and medical offices. RPGA's distinct client list includes homes in elite Fort Worth neighborhoods such as Mira Vista, West Briar, Trinity Heights and Westover Hills. RPGA's work can also be seen in many of Dallas's elite neighborhoods such as Turtle Creek, State Thomas, North Oak Cliff, and East Dallas. The client list expands beyond the DFW area and includes a wide variety of other exclusive neighborhoods throughout Texas and the United States. RPGA's commercial portfolio includes mixed use developments such as Mercado Fort Worth, The Village at Colleyville, retail/office space planning at Southlake Town Square, DISD, Dallas, Irving,Fort Worth, & Southlake.

Areas of Expertise

  • RPGA Design Group, Inc. - Architects have worked on a wide variety of projects ranging from a 400 square foot addition on a residence to 75,000 square foot elementary school to 110,000 square foot headquarters public safety facility.
  • RPGA areas of specialty are 3 distinct markets:
  • - Commercial Office, Retail and space planning
  • - Residential, High-End single family, multi-family and condominium projects
  • - Municipal and Institutional projects

What is RPGA's typical size of project and FEE structure?

RPGA's work ranges from 400 sq. ft. residential addition to multi-million dollar commecial projects and our FEE is 10%-12% of the construction cost.

What is the screening process that Service Professionals go through in order to become members of the HomeAdvisor network?

  1. Verify Trade License
    HomeAdvisor checks to see if the business carries the appropriate state-level license.
  2. Verify Insurance
    As a part of our screening process, we encourage professionals to carry general liability insurance. We require coverage for hundreds of services.
  3. Verification of State Business Filings
    For business types that require a Secretary of State filing, we confirm that the business is in good standing in the state in which it is located.
  4. Criminal Records Search
    HomeAdvisor uses 3rd party data sources to conduct a criminal search for any relevant criminal activity associated with the owner/principal of the business.
  5. Sex Offender Search
    We confirm that the owner/principal is not listed on the official state Sex Offender web site in the state in which the owner/principal of the company is located.
  6. Bankruptcy Search
    We use 3rd party data sources to check the history of the principal/owner of the business for bankruptcy filings by or against them.
  7. Legal Search for Civil Judgments
    We use 3rd party data sources to check the principal/owner of the business for state level civil legal judgments entered against them.
  8. Liens Search
    We use 3rd party data sources to check the principal/owner of the business for liens placed against them.
  9. Identity Verification (SSN)
    HomeAdvisor verifies the social security number(s) of the owner/principal for identity check purposes. This check applies primarily to smaller business entities.
  10. Identity Verification (Reverse Phone Lookup)
    We conduct a reverse business phone lookup to identify records matching the phone number information provided by the business.
